Shaik Zainuddin

Associate Professor of Materials Science and Engineering, Tuskegee University

Shaik Zainuddin is an Associate Professor of Materials Science and Engineering at Tuskegee University. He received his B.E. in Mechanical Engineering from India, and M.S. and Ph.D. in Mechanical and Materials Science Engineering from TU.

He has served in different positions at TU and is a Director of Research Experience for Undergraduates (REU), Research Initiation Award (RIA) and Target Infusion Project (TIP) programs at TU. He is also serving as an associate editor, reviewer, consultant and scientific member of peer-reviewed journals/committees.

His research interests are in the areas of processing and characterization of polymer and fiber reinforced composite materials, biomaterials and sandwich composites; durability, life prediction, computational simulations, nanomechanical and tribological properties of nanocomposites and polymer coated metals.
